Embodiment Construction

[0014] Such as figure 1 As shown, a smart grid optical fiber composite low-voltage cable of the present invention includes an outer sheath 8, and the outer sheath 8 is provided with a power cable, an optical cable 1 and a radio frequency cable 6, and the power cable, the optical cable 1 and the radio frequency cable 6 are arranged in an orderly manner Stranded. The optical cable 1 is wrapped with a longitudinal aluminum-plastic composite tape, and the aluminum-plastic composite tape is wrapped with a water-blocking tape, which can maximize the horizontal and vertical water-blocking effects of the optical cable 1, thereby ensuring the design performance and service life of the cable. Abstract

The invention discloses an optical fiber composite low-voltage cable for a smart grid, comprising an outer sheath, wherein the outer sheath is internally provided with a power cable, an optical cable and a radio-frequency cable which are mutually twisted, the optical cable is wrapped with a longitudinal Al-plastic composite tape, the Al-plastic composite tape is wrapped with a waterproof tape, the power cable comprises a conductor and an irradiation cross-linked polyethylene insulating layer wrapped outside the conductor, the power cable, the optical cable and the radio-frequency cable are coated with a non-hygroscopic wrapping tape, the outer sheath is wrapped outside the non-hygroscopic wrapping tape, and a non-hygroscopic filler is filled between the non-hygroscopic wrapping tape as well as the power cable, the optical cable and the radio-frequency cable. The invention has the beneficial effects that the comprehensive cost is low, the stability of product performance is guaranteed, the electrical energy loss in an application process is reduced, the electrical energy can be more stably transmitted, and the electrical property of the cable is guaranteed, thus the electrical energy can be effectively transmitted.

technical field [0001] The invention relates to a cable, in particular to a smart grid optical fiber composite low-voltage cable. Background technique [0002] With the deepening of the smart grid construction, the country will continue to increase the promotion of the integration of the four networks on the basis of the integration of the three networks. Another important market segment. Smart grid construction puts forward new requirements for traditional optical cables and power transmission. It needs to integrate optical fiber communication, signal transmission and power transmission to meet the needs of smart grid informatization, automation, and interaction. It provides safe and reliable guarantee for the smart grid, and provides technical support for the construction and implementation of the Internet of Things.
